    Description

    Libraries are the best way to control reusable code and can shave hours and hours off of a project. Siemens TIA Portal has one of, if not the best, Library management control systems.

    Learn how to get up and running with Libraries in ~2 hours. Here's what this course covers:

    · Learn how to use the Project Library

    · Learn how to use the Global Library

    · Learn the difference between Type blocks and Master Copy blocks

    · Learn how to manage Block Versions

    · Learn how to troubleshoot inconsistency issues

    · Learn how to upgrade objects and their dependants

    · Learn how to update Project Libraries from Global Libraries (and the other way around)

    · Learn how to protect Global Libraries

    · Plus a few more little gems of information!

    Getting to grips with Library management in TIA Portal is essential for anyone looking to become competent with the TIA Portal Platform in their career. By understanding how to use Libraries, engineers can safeguard and version their standard control blocks, ensuring that modifications are versioned and 3rd parties use standard software.

    This course teaches how to create your own global library so that you can get started with creating a reusable, standard code-set that is sharable with other users and projects
